Medium RiskFDA Device

Intuitive Surgical, Inc.: Specific lots of the Instrument Arm Drapes were manufactured with a sterile adaptor that may have difficulty engaging an instrument.

Agency Publication Date: July 27, 2012
Share:
Sign in to monitor this recall

Affected Products

Product: INSTRUMENT ARM DRAPE IS2000, 20 PACK: Product Usage: The intended use of the Instrument arm drape is to protect equipment from contamination and to maintain a sterile field during surgical procedures using the da Vinci Surgical Systems.

Part number: 420015-03; Lot numbers: D120745A, D120765, D120795, D120845, D120895A, D120935, D120955. EXPANDED - added lot DA121075.
